How To Store Fudgy Brownie Pie

To ensure your Brownie Pie stays fresh and delicious for longer, follow these simple storage tips:

Cool completely: Allow the pie to cool completely at room temperature before storing.

Airtight Container: Cover the pie tightly with plastic wrap, aluminum foil or use an airtight container this is to protect it from drying out and absorbing any unwanted odors in the refrigerator.

Refrigerator: Store the pie in the refrigerator for up to 4-5 days to maintain its texture and flavor.

Freezer: For longer storage, tightly wrap individual slices in plastic wrap or place them in an airtight container and freeze for up to 2-3 months. Put the slices in the refrigerator overnight before eating.


By following these storage guidelines, you can extend the 'shelf life' of your Brownie Pie and enjoy its deliciousness even days after baking.





VEGAN FUDGY BROWNIE RECIPE

VEGAN FUDGY BROWNIE PIE

Prep-Time: 10 mins

Baking Time: 20-25 mins

Amount: 1 brownie pie


INGREDIENTS

  • 120 g dark vegan chocolate

  • 50 ml neutral oil

  • 150 g white sugar

  • 80 ml water

  • 130 g plain flour

  • 1/2 tsp salt

  • 20 g unsweetened cocoa powder

  • 1 tsp baking powder

  • 300g storebought vegan puff pastry (you might need more if you use a bit pie tin)

  • vegan whipped cream (I used Oatly)



INSTRUCTIONS

1. Preheat the oven to 180° degrees (356 F).

2. Prepare a water bath (bain marie) by placing a heatproof bowl over simmering water. Combine oil, water, sugar, and chocolate in the bowl. Heat the mixture gently, stirring continuously until the chocolate is completely melted and the mixture turns smooth and glossy. Set it aside for now.

3. Take a pie tin and carefully line it with the puff pastry, ensuring a snug fit. Set the pie tin aside, and let's move on to the next step.

4. In a large mixing bowl, combine the remaining ingredients with the prepared chocolate syrup. Mix everything together until all the ingredients are thoroughly incorporated. Pour it into the prepared pie tin, spreading it evenly.

5. Place the pie tin in the preheated oven and bake for approximately 20 minutes, or until the pastry turns golden brown. After baking, resist the temptation to dig in immediately! Allow the dessert to rest for a few hours.

7. Once the brownie pie has fully set, add whipped cream on top, followed by some grated chocolate, carefully slice into it and indulge in the rich, chocolatey goodness.
